Marcin Slusarz
|
887cd78804
drm/nv50: rename INVALID_QUERY_OR_TEXTURE error to INVALID_OPERATION
|
13 years ago |
Marcin Slusarz
|
547e6c7fc8
drm/nv50: decode PGRAPH DATA_ERROR = 0x24
|
13 years ago |
Ben Skeggs
|
c420b2dc8d
drm/nouveau/fifo: turn all fifo modules into engine modules
|
13 years ago |
Ben Skeggs
|
a226c32a38
drm/nv50/graph: remove ability to do interrupt-driven context switching
|
13 years ago |
Ben Skeggs
|
5511d490da
drm/nv50: remove manual context unload on context destruction
|
13 years ago |
Ben Skeggs
|
7f2062e9de
drm/nv50: remove execution engine context saves on suspend
|
13 years ago |
Ben Skeggs
|
67b342efc7
drm/nouveau/fifo: remove all the "special" engine hooks
|
13 years ago |
Ben Skeggs
|
20abd1634a
drm/nouveau: create real execution engine for software object class
|
13 years ago |
Ben Skeggs
|
d58086deaa
drm/nv40-50/gr: restructure grctx/prog generation
|
13 years ago |
Maxim Levitsky
|
c983e6f660
drm/nv50: also report errors in MP1/MP2 when they happen.
|
13 years ago |
Ben Skeggs
|
dce411cdf6
drm/nv50/gr: typo fix, how about we not reset fifo during graph init?
|
13 years ago |
Ben Skeggs
|
6d6538a0c3
drm/nv50/gr: refactor initialisation
|
14 years ago |
Linus Torvalds
|
757c26b804
Merge branch 'drm-core-next' of git://git.kernel.org/pub/scm/linux/kernel/git/airlied/drm-2.6
|
14 years ago |
Ben Skeggs
|
9962cc6eba
drm/nouveau/gr: disable fifo access and idle before suspend ctx unload
|
14 years ago |
Ben Skeggs
|
6c320fef58
drm/nouveau: pass flag to engine fini() method on suspend
|
14 years ago |
Vitaliy Ivanov
|
e44ba033c5
treewide: remove duplicate includes
|
14 years ago |
Ben Skeggs
|
7ff5441e55
drm/nva3: implement support for copy engine
|
14 years ago |
Ben Skeggs
|
a82dd49f14
drm/nouveau: remove remnants of nouveau_pgraph_engine
|
14 years ago |
Ben Skeggs
|
2703c21a82
drm/nv50/gr: move to exec engine interfaces
|
14 years ago |
Ben Skeggs
|
4ea52f8974
drm/nouveau: move engine object creation into per-engine hooks
|
14 years ago |
Emil Velikov
|
0b89a072f9
drm/nouveau: Fix missing whitespace checkpatch.pl errors.
|
14 years ago |
Emil Velikov
|
f9ec8f6c8d
drm/nouveau: Fix brace placement checkpatch.pl errors.
|
14 years ago |
Ben Skeggs
|
2b4cebe4e1
drm/nv50: use "nv86" tlb flush method on everything except 0x50/0xac
|
14 years ago |
Ben Skeggs
|
6fdb383e81
drm/nv50: check for vm traps on every gr irq
|
14 years ago |
Ben Skeggs
|
bb9b18a390
drm/nouveau: add nouveau_enum_find() util function
|
14 years ago |
Ben Skeggs
|
562af10c67
drm/nv50: flesh out ZCULL init and match nvidia on later chipsets
|
14 years ago |
Marcin Slusarz
|
4dcf905c84
drm/nv50: fix typos in CCACHE error reporting
|
14 years ago |
Ben Skeggs
|
d7117e0d4e
drm/nv50: enable page flipping
|
14 years ago |
Francisco Jerez
|
34311c7301
drm/nv50: Fix race with PFIFO during PGRAPH context destruction.
|
14 years ago |
Ben Skeggs
|
6effe39364
drm/nv50: sync up gr data error names with rnn, use for nvc0 also
|
14 years ago |